STORYLINE:
Austrians on Wednesday mourned the death of President Thomas Klestil, whose casket was laid in state at the Hofburg imperial palace in central Vienna, where the presidency is based.
Klestil, who had suffered from ill health in recent years, was airlifted to hospital on Monday in critical condition after suffering heart failure.
The 71-year-old died on Tuesday of multiple organ failure, just two days before the end of his second six-year term.
Four days of mourning began with Klestil's casket arriving at Hofburg and thousands of people filing past to pay their final respects.
Austria's new president, Heinz Fischer, as well as Chancellor Dr Wolfgang Schueffel both expressed their condolences to Klestil's widow, Margot Loeffler-Klestil, and the couple's children and other relatives.
A memorial service, open to the public, is to be held on Friday in a chapel in the Hofburg.
Klestil is to be laid to rest on Saturday in a state funeral at Vienna's Central Cemetery following a requiem Mass at St. Stephen's Cathedral, the Austria Press Agency said.
Condolences came in from around the world for a leader praised for improving Austria's standing in the world and for developing relations with emerging Eastern European nations.
Klestil also was credited with helping to distance Austria from its Nazi past after years of controversy over his predecessor Kurt Waldheim's World War II service in the German army.
Klestil's first term included a visit to Israel, where he expressed sympathy for Holocaust victims.
Critics occasionally accused Klestil of overstepping the ceremonial bounds of his office.
But he proved an efficient president, and in 1995, during his first term, Austria joined the European Union.
When the European Union punished Austria for allowing the rightist Freedom Party to join the government, Klestil put his diplomatic skills to work and lobbied heads of states to lift sanctions seven months after they were slapped on the nation.
Fischer, who was chosen in elections earlier this year as Austria's next president, takes over Klestil's job on Thursday.
While the post is mostly ceremonial, Austria's president is commander in chief of the country's military.
The constitution also gives the head of state the power to reject nominations for cabinet ministers or even to remove them from office - something that has rarely been done.
